在實際系統中,人機界面與PLC通常不在一起,中心計算機一般放置在控制室,而PLC安裝在現場車間,二者之間距離往往從幾十米到幾千米。如果布線的話,需要挖溝施工,比較麻煩,這種情況下比較適合采用無線通信方式。因為采用無線PPI協議響應速度快且不需要編程,只需要組態,所以用戶更喜歡采用PPI協議網絡。但是實現無線PPI通信需要專門的無線數據終端,在組態時也要考慮設置參數的匹配性。
本方案以力控軟件為例,介紹力控軟件與兩臺S7-200Smart PLC的無線 PPI 通信實現過程。在本方案中采用了西門子PLC專用無線通訊終端DTD434M,作為實現無線通訊的硬件設備。
一、方案概述
1.有線 PPI 網絡
本方案中力控配置為標準 PPI 主站,西門子 PLC 配置為PPI從站,使用簡單方便,不必深入理解 PPI 協議細節,即可完成通信。
2.無線 PPI 網絡
通過歐美系PLC專用無線通訊終端DTD434M,能夠穩定方便的實現無線 PPI網絡,無需更改網絡參數或原有程序,直接替換有線Rs485通訊。
二、實驗設備與接線
·組態軟件:力控6.1
·200SMART型號:CPU SR20 * 1臺
·無線通訊終端:DTD434MC * 2臺
三、力控實現PPI主站
1.將力控組態例程拷貝到力控軟件工程目錄下。
如下圖目錄所示路徑,搜索項目,啟動開發。
2.組態測試界面
3.IO設備組態
選擇 S7-200(PPI)協議。
設備配置按如下步驟進行。
第一步:
第二步:
4.數據庫組態
分別為兩臺S7-200Smart進行變量組態。
I0是第一臺PLC的開關輸入,M0是M存儲區,Q0是開關輸出。
第一臺的PLC地址是2,第二臺地址是3.
這里選擇一個字節代表8個開關量。
四、西門子PLC實現PPI從站
1. 選擇系統塊進入
2. 地址設置一臺PLC地址設為2,另外一臺PLC地址設為3
3. CPU模式選擇:RUN
4. S7-200SMART的程序
例程源代碼里已提供測試程序
5. 實物接線圖
五、測試方法
由200SMART的I0.0和I0.1的輸入開關可以確認通信是否正常
用鼠標點擊(長按)M0.0=1為紅色時,Q0.0=1也為紅色
把S7-200Smart的I0.1設置為高電平時,顯示I0.1=1,Q0.1=1;
說明力控與S7-200Smart的PPI通信正常。
審核編輯:湯梓紅
-
plc
+關注
關注
5013文章
13327瀏覽量
464065 -
無線通訊
+關注
關注
5文章
586瀏覽量
40155 -
上位機
+關注
關注
27文章
944瀏覽量
54883 -
S7-200
+關注
關注
13文章
408瀏覽量
50479
發布評論請先 登錄
相關推薦
評論